Holden Special Vehicles has hit the Australian International Motor Show (AIMS) floor with a collection of high performance, limited production models dubbed 'SV Black Edition'.

Based on ClubSport R8, ClubSport Tourer R8 and Maloo R8 derivatives, the enhanced models include matt black detailing, Vector hood scoop and fender gills, HSV's bi-modal exhaust system, and, for the first time in the brand's production history, 20-inch forged alloy wheels – dropping an impressive five kilos per corner from the car's unsprung weight.

Inside, the goodies list continues with a unique dash treatment, leather seats and leather-bound steering wheel on top of the already generous E3 equipment list. A reversing camera, park assist and satellite navigation is also offered as standard as part of HSV's Enhanced Driver Interface (EDI) data logging system.

The EDI system includes a map of every racetrack in Australia and can even been tailored for new circuits in the future. Lap times, additional gauges (including power, torque, manifold pressure, fuel, elevation, voltage, oil and air temperature), stop watch, G-force meter, dynamics (oversteer and understeer), fuel economy, data logging, SBZA display, bi-modal exhaust operation, MRC display and even race-cam-style telemetry are included in the system.

The system includes software for your laptop (Windows OS only) to allow you analyse your track day in depth -- perfect for honing your skills behind the wheel.

Like all HSV models, SV Black Edition models are fitted with Competition Mode stability control with Launch Assist (on manual models only).

HSV says the SV Black Edition incorporates in excess of $7000 of additional value against the derivative models, but is priced at only $3000 more than the entry-level Maloo R8 and $4000 more than ClubSport R8 and ClubSport Tourer R8 (see pricing below).

Despite the name, SV Black Edition models are available in five colours: Sting Red, Heron White, Alto Grey, Nitrate Silver and (of course) Phantom (black). But numbers are strictly limited -- just 225 SV Black Edition HSVs will be built. The wagon version will be the rarest (at a build number of only 25) while 100 each of the sedan and ute will be constructed.

Pre-orders commence today (July 1) with the official 'on sale' date being September 1.

The Australian International Motor Show opens to the public at 6pm Friday, July 1 at the Melbourne Exhibition and Convention Centre.

HSV SV Black Edition pricing
- Maloo R8 $67,990 (man./auto.)
- ClubSport R8 $71,990 (man./auto.)
- ClubSport R8 Tourer $72,990 (man./auto.)
